Pinned Repositories
sonic
Sonic is a blogging platform developed by Go. Simple and powerful
redis
Redis is an in-memory database that persists on disk. The data model is key-value, but many different kind of values are supported: Strings, Lists, Sets, Sorted Sets, Hashes, Streams, HyperLogLogs, Bitmaps.
a-picture-is-worth-a-1000-words
I am trying to describe complex matters in simple doodles!
algorithms
Minimal examples of data structures and algorithms in Python
dht-1
BitTorrent DHT Protocol && DHT Spider
h2o
HTTP server / library implementation with support for HTTP/1, HTTP/2, websocket
my-git
学习git的个人过程整理,不断更细
mydumper
Official mydumper project
redisTopK
A tool to find redis top n keys by key serialized length
shnwang's Repositories
shnwang/raspi3-tutorial
Bare metal Raspberry Pi 3 tutorials
shnwang/db_tutorial
Writing a sqlite clone from scratch in C
shnwang/redis
Redis is an in-memory database that persists on disk. The data model is key-value, but many different kind of values are supported: Strings, Lists, Sets, Sorted Sets, Hashes, HyperLogLogs, Bitmaps.
shnwang/taskflow
A General-purpose Parallel and Heterogeneous Task Programming System
shnwang/RaspberryPi
Raspberry Pi Bare Metal Assembly Programming
shnwang/innodb-java-reader
A library and command-line tool to access MySQL InnoDB data file directly in Java
shnwang/HelloZooKeeper
你好 ZooKeeper!从 0 系统地讲解 ZooKeeper 的教程
shnwang/icecream
🍦 Never use print() to debug again.
shnwang/uber_go_guide_cn
Uber Go 语言编码规范中文版. The Uber Go Style Guide .
shnwang/golang
《Golang修养之路》本书针对Golang专题性热门技术深入理解,修养在Golang领域深入话题,脱胎换骨。
shnwang/darkhttpd
When you need a web server in a hurry.
shnwang/coreutils
Cross-platform Rust rewrite of the GNU coreutils
shnwang/olivia
💁♀️Your new best friend powered by an artificial neural network
shnwang/rqlite
The lightweight, distributed relational database built on SQLite
shnwang/Practical-Cryptography-for-Developers-Book
Practical Cryptography for Developers: Hashes, MAC, Key Derivation, DHKE, Symmetric and Asymmetric Ciphers, Public Key Cryptosystems, RSA, Elliptic Curves, ECC, secp256k1, ECDH, ECIES, Digital Signatures, ECDSA, EdDSA
shnwang/minilisp
A readable lisp in less than 1k lines of C
shnwang/maia-chess
Maia is a human-like neural network chess engine trained on millions of human games.
shnwang/Ceres
Ceres - an MCTS chess engine for research and recreation
shnwang/supertag
A tag-based filesystem
shnwang/BuildYourOwnLisp
Learn C and build your own programming language in under 1000 lines of code!
shnwang/malnet-graph
A large-scale database for graph representation learning
shnwang/golang-tls
Simple Golang HTTPS/TLS Examples
shnwang/stdx
The missing batteries of Rust
shnwang/Go42
《Go语言四十二章经》详细讲述Go语言规范与语法细节及开发中常见的误区,通过研读标准库等经典代码设计模式,启发读者深刻理解Go语言的核心思维,进入Go语言开发的更高阶段。
shnwang/GhostDB
GhostDB is a distributed, in-memory, general purpose key-value data store that delivers microsecond performance at any scale.
shnwang/MagicMagnet-Python
Get magnet links from internet without any effort! 🧲
shnwang/PurritoBin
ultra fast, minimalistic, encrypted command line paste-bin
shnwang/ultimate-go
Ultimate Go study guide
shnwang/toydb
Distributed SQL database in Rust, written as a learning project
shnwang/terminus-server
open source model driven graph database for knowledge graph representation.